Synthesis and Potato Cell Expansion-inducing Activity of the Stereochemically Restricted Bicyclic Analogue of 7-Epi-jasmonic Acid

, , &
Pages 2702-2705 | Received 05 Jun 2000, Accepted 11 Jul 2000, Published online: 22 May 2014
 

Abstract

The stereochemically restricted bicyclic analogue of 7-epi-jasmonic acid was synthesized from a known bicyclo[3.3.0]octane derivative. The enol triflate derived from the bicyclic compound was subjected to palladium-catalyzed coupling with allyltributyltin to give the desired carbon skeleton. Selective catalytic hydrogenation and subsequent acidic hydrolysis gave a new bicyclic analogue of 7-epi-jasmonic acid. The ACC conjugate of the bicyclic analogue was also synthesized. This ACC conjugate exhibited only slightly weaker potato cell expansion-inducing activity than that of the JA standard.
